After four weeks of evidence and testimony, attorneys in R. Kelly’s Chicago federal trial are slated to begin closing arguments Monday morning.

R. Kelly is seen in a courtroom sketch during his federal trial on Aug. 19, 2022, at the Dirksen U.S. Courthouse.

Attorneys began their arguments after four weeks of evidence and testimony, and the presentations promise to be fiery as well as lengthy. Arguments from prosecutors as well as lawyers for Kelly and former associates Derrel McDavid and Milton “June” Brown are expected to last all day and could even spill into Tuesday, when jury deliberations are set to begin.

Closing Arguments Set for R. Kelly Trial on Fixing ChargesClosing Arguments Set for R. Kelly Trial on Fixing ChargesClosing arguments are scheduled Monday for R. Kelly and two co-defendants in the R&B singer’s trial on federal charges of trial-fixing, child pornography and enticing minors for sex. Jury deliberations will follow. The defense rested late Friday. Kelly and his ex-business manager Derrell McDavid are charged with fixing Kelly’s 2008 state child pornography trial — at which Kelly was acquitted — by threatening witnesses and concealing video evidence. Both also face child pornography charges. A third co-defendant, Kelly associate Milton Brown, is accused of receiving child pornography. The 55-year-old Kelly already was sentenced to 30 years in prison in June after a separate federal trial in New York.
